File: Rakefile

package info (click to toggle)
ruby-enumerable-statistics 2.0.1%2Bdfsg-3
  • links: PTS, VCS
  • area: main
  • in suites: bullseye
  • size: 1,036 kB
  • sloc: ansic: 1,808; ruby: 679; makefile: 11; sh: 4
file content (22 lines) | stat: -rw-r--r-- 459 bytes parent folder |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
require "bundler/gem_tasks"
require "rake/extensiontask"
require "rspec/core/rake_task"

task :default => :spec

Rake::ExtensionTask.new('enumerable/statistics/extension')

directory 'lib/enumerable/statistics'

RSpec::Core::RakeTask.new(:spec)

task :bench do
  puts "# sum\n"
  system('benchmark-driver bench/sum.yml')

  puts "# mean\n"
  system('benchmark-driver bench/mean.yml')

  puts "# variance\n"
  system('benchmark-driver bench/variance.yml')
end